Two co-workers died in a road accident on Jalan Sungai Besi, Kuala Lumpur after returning from their company dinner on Sunday, 17 May
According to Bernama, Kuala Lumpur Traffic Investigation and Enforcement Department (JSPT) chief Mohd Zamzuri Mohd Isa said the 29-year-old male victim was driving a Honda City hatchback with a 23-year-old female colleague in the front passenger seat.
He said the victims were believed to have been on their way back to Ampang after attending a dinner event organised by an international banking company.
"Preliminary investigations found that while navigating a bend at the scene, the driver is believed to have lost control of the vehicle before skidding and crashing into a pillar on the left side of the road, causing the car to catch fire," said Mohd Zamzuri.
The Cheras fire and rescue station rushed to the scene to extinguish the fire and extricated the victims from the vehicle.

They were confirmed dead by medical officers, with the driver suffering severe burns and the passenger sustaining serious head injuries
The case is currently being probed under Section 41(1) of the Road Transport Act 1987 for causing death by reckless driving, and efforts are underway to obtain CCTV footage from the scene.
